Clingendael Research, a French think tank that produces” state-of-the-art analyses and plan research in foreign affairs for governments, businesses andNGO’s”, reported that “in 2018, the People’s Republic of China published its second Arctic strategy, claiming that the Middle Kingdom is a’ near-Arctic state.'” It added that “it is fast becoming clear that China has built a geostrategic appearance in the Arctic that is not to be sniggered at. It is already reshaping latitudinal politics in basic ways”.  ,
Advertisement
The report detailed intense Chinese activity in Greenland beginning in 2005 and noted that” the void created when Greenland was given greater autonomy ]in 2009 ] from central authorities in the Kingdom of Denmark and subsequently left the EEC was happily filled by China.  , Even though the Kingdom of Denmark remains concerned for foreign policy and military, Greenland is now argue international partnerships with overseas says on its own. This raises concerns for both the Kingdom of Denmark and the EU”. However” While the Arctic rises in political and geo-economic importance, the EU has been slower to evaluate its corporate interests”.
